コンテンツにスキップ
関数 >

戻り値一覧

戻り値
(16進数値/10進数値)
意味 対処方法
YDX_RESULT_SUCCESS
(00000000h / 0)
正常終了
YDX_RESULT_NOT_OPEN
(CE000002h / -838860798)
オープンされていません YdxOpen関数 にてオープンをしてください。
YDX_RESULT_ALREADY_OPEN
(CE000003h / -838860797)
既にオープンされています  
YDX_RESULT_INVALID_ID
(CE000004h / -838860796)
指定されたIDが不正です YdxOpen関数 で取得したIDを指定してください。
YDX_RESULT_CANNOT_OPEN
(CE000006h / -838860794)
オープンできませんでした 以下の原因などが考えられます。
1. 供給電源電圧が定格範囲を外れてしまっている。
(供給電源の電流容量不足による電圧低下など)
2. USBケーブルまたは電源ケーブルの接続不良
3. ユニット識別スイッチの設定が間違っている
4. デバイスドライバがインストールできていない
上記を確認しても問題が見当たらない場合は、どのような状況で発生したかを弊社サポートまでご連絡ください。
YDX_RESULT_MEM_ALLOC_ERROR
(CE000009h / -838860791)
利用可能なメモリが不足しています 不要なアプリケーションを終了するなどして、利用可能なメモリを増やしてください。
YDX_RESULT_MODELNAME_ERROR
(CE00000Ah / -838860790)
指定された型名は存在していないか、サポートしていません 型名に間違いがないか確認してください。
YDX_RESULT_HARDWARE_ERROR
(CE00000Bh / -838860789)
ハードウェアにエラーが発生しました ハードウェアが故障している可能性があります。
どのような状況で発生したかを弊社サポートまでご連絡ください。
YDX_RESULT_NOT_SUPPORTED
(CE00000Ch / -838860788)
サポートされていない関数が実行されました  
YDX_RESULT_INVALID_UNIT_SW
(CE000020h / -838860768)
指定されたユニット識別スイッチの値が不正です 0~15を指定してください。 
YDX_RESULT_UNIT_NUM_OVER
(CE000021h / -838860767)
接続可能な台数を超えました 同時にオープンできるユニットは32台まで(同一機種は16台まで)です。 
YDX_RESULT_DISCONNECT
(CE000022h / -838860766)
通信が切断されました 以下の原因などが考えられます。
1. 動作中に供給電源電圧が定格範囲を外れてしまっている
(供給電源の電流容量不足による電圧低下など)
2. USBケーブルまたは電源ケーブルの接続不良
3. パソコンがスリープ(スタンバイ)や休止状態になった
上記を確認しても問題が見当たらない場合は、どのような状況で発生したかを弊社サポートまでご連絡ください。
再び使用する場合は、YdxClose関数 でクローズをしてから、YdxOpen関数 でオープンをしなおしてください。
YDX_RESULT_COMMUNICATE_ERROR
(CE000030h / -838860752)
通信エラーが発生しました USB通信に異常が発生しました。
近くにノイズ要因がないか確認してください。
確認しても問題が見当たらない場合は、どのような状況で発生したかを弊社サポートまでご連絡ください。
YDX_RESULT_COMMUNICATE_TIMEOUT
(CE00003Fh / -838860737)
通信タイムアウトが発生しました
YDX_RESULT_PARAMETER1_ERROR
(CE000041h / -838860735)
引数1が不正です関数仕様やサンプルプログラムを参照し、引数の確認をしてください。
YDX_RESULT_PARAMETER2_ERROR
(CE000042h / -838860734)
引数2が不正です
YDX_RESULT_PARAMETER3_ERROR
(CE000043h / -838860733)
引数3が不正です
YDX_RESULT_PARAMETER4_ERROR
(CE000044h / -838860732)
引数4が不正です
YDX_RESULT_PARAMETER5_ERROR
(CE000045h / -838860731)
引数5が不正です
YDX_RESULT_PARAMETER1_NULL
(CE000049h / -838860727)
引数1がNULLです
YDX_RESULT_PARAMETER2_NULL
(CE00004Ah / -838860726)
引数2がNULLです
YDX_RESULT_PARAMETER3_NULL
(CE00004Bh / -838860725)
引数3がNULLです
YDX_RESULT_PARAMETER4_NULL
(CE00004Ch / -838860724)
引数4がNULLです
YDX_RESULT_PARAMETER5_NULL
(CE00004Dh / -838860723)
引数5がNULLです
YDX_RESULT_DI_BUSY
(CE0000A0h / -838860640)
デジタル入力が 動作中 です  
YDX_RESULT_DI_ERROR
(CE0000A1h / -838860639)
デジタル入力動作 はエラー停止しています YdxDiReset関数 を実行して、エラーを解除してください。
YDX_RESULT_DI_END
(CE0000A2h / -838860638)
デジタル入力動作は終了しています 指定されたリピート回数の動作は終了しています。
同じ条件で再度動作させたい場合は、YdxDiClearData関数 を実行して動作済みリピート回数をクリアしてください。
YDX_RESULT_DI_EXCEED_DATA_NUM
(CE0000A8h / -838860632)
変換されたデータ数を超えるデータを取得しようとしました。
sampleNumを最大値にしてデータを取得しました
 
YDX_RESULT_DI_EXCEED_BUF_SIZ
(CE0000A9h / -838860631)
データバッファ容量を超えるデータを取得しようとしました。
sampleNumを最大値にしてデータを取得しました
 
YDX_RESULT_DO_BUSY
(CE0000B0h / -838860624)
デジタル出力が 動作中 です  
YDX_RESULT_DO_ERROR
(CE0000B1h / -838860623)
デジタル出力動作 はエラー停止しています YdxDoReset関数 を実行して、エラーを解除してください。
YDX_RESULT_DO_END
(CE0000B2h / -838860622)
デジタル出力動作は終了しています 指定されたリピート回数の動作は終了しています。
同じ条件で再度動作させたい場合は、YdxDoClearData関数 を実行して動作済みリピート回数をクリアしてください。
YDX_RESULT_DO_NO_CHANNEL
(CE0000B3h / -838860621)
デジタル出力チャネルが設定されていません YdxDoSetChannel関数 で、高機能デジタル出力をおこなうチャネルを指定してください。
YDX_RESULT_DO_NO_DATA
(CE0000B8h / -838860616)
データが設定されていません YdxDoSetData関数 で、データを設定してください。
YDX_RESULT_DO_EXCEED_BUF_SIZ
(CE0000B9h / -838860615)
データバッファ容量を超えるデータを設定しようとしました  
YDX_RESULT_FATAL_ERROR
(CEFFFFFFh / -822083585)
致命的なエラー どのような状況で発生したかを弊社サポートまでご連絡ください。